Can alcohol cause retinal detachment?

Vitamin Deficiency Also, a vitamin A deficiency due to excessive alcohol consumption can cause a thinning of the cornea, corneal perforation, night blindness, dryness and due to retinal damage, even blindness in some extreme cases.

Can alcohol damage eye?

As far as the eyes are concerned, alcohol weakens the muscles of your eye; it can damage the optic nerves permanently, preventing the interaction of the brain and eyes. Double and distorted vision can occur from information that is slowed down between the eye and the brain.

Can damaged retina repair itself?

Yes, in many cases an eye doctor can repair a damaged retina. While a patient may not experience completely restored vision, retinal repair can prevent further vision loss and stabilize vision. It’s important that patients get treatment for their damaged retinas as soon as possible.

How long does it take for eyes to clear after alcohol?

Double vision or blurry vision after drinking alcohol can be temporary effects of intoxication or a hangover. This effect is not long-lasting as it is just due to a hangover, and its side effects are apparent after you get sobered, thereby clearing your sight in 24 hours.

How does alcohol affect your peripheral vision?

Decreased Peripheral Vision Drinking alcohol may decrease the sensitivity of your peripheral vision. 3  This may give you the effect or perception of having tunnel vision.

Can alcohol and tobacco cause vision loss?

Even though studies have shown the vision loss to be a result of a nutritional deficiency, some professionals believe that the condition develops because of toxic effects of alcohol and tobacco. Optic neuropathy can also develop as a result of methanol poisoning.

How does fetal alcohol syndrome affect the eyes?

According to a review by the Emory University School of Medicine, many eye problems are associated with Fetal Alcohol Syndrome including underdevelopment of the optic nerve, difficulty with eye coordination, and the tendency for eyelids to droop.
